Good advice for app development

Are you considering having  an app developed or your company? Then there are a lot of considerations and questions you have to ask yourself. It is not always that an app is the best solution. We have collected a number of good tips for those of you who are considering developing an app.

 

What is the purpose of the app?

It is first and foremost important to clarify what the purpose of the app is and who the target audience for the app is.

Understand the target audience

It is crucial for the success of your app that you understand the target group and its needs. If you find it difficult to define who your target group is, it will also be difficult for you to be successful with an app - because what are the target group's needs? What challenges does the app solve for the target group? Why should the target audience come back and use the app several times?

Know the market

When you know the target group and its needs, you must also research the market: Are there other apps that solve the same needs? How does your app differ from the competition?

Do your research

When you have defined the purpose of your app, the target group and you have researched the market for similar solutions, it is a good idea to also investigate whether your target group will download your app. The easiest way to find this out is to ask different people in the target group.

If the app is intended as a work tool, ask the employees if they want to use the app as a tool in their work. Also ask the employees which functions and features they would like in the app. This knowledge is particularly valuable for you when you have to develop the app.

We have previously developed an app for roofers and builders (Tagpas, read the case here), which collects different work tasks, provides an overview and facilitates the documentation of their work. In this example, the app is a good solution because the roofers have their phone close at hand - and therefore they don't have to go past a computer and upload pictures and fill in various forms to complete a task.

 

What features should the app have?

When you have the basis for your app in place (and you know that the target group is interested in the app), you must find out which features and functions the app must have. Here it can be a good idea to include the functions that the target group themselves demand, so use the knowledge you have gained by talking to the target group.

In addition, you need to find out whether the app is to be integrated with other systems or platforms? Should the app use any of the phone's functions, e.g. camera, gps, bluetooth, pedometer, etc.? Should the app be connected to IoT devices?

It is a good idea to define the core functions of the app. What must the app be able to do to fulfill its purpose? What must the app be able to do to meet the needs of the target group? How does the app differ from the competition?

In order to ensure a good user experience, it is important that an abundance of redundant functions and features are not added. Keep it simple! If there are too many (redundant) functions, there is a risk that it will affect user-friendliness or that the app will take up too much space on users' phones.

 

What should the app look like?

When you know what the app should be able to do, you can start planning how it should look and how users should navigate the app. Perhaps you have some brand colors that the app must follow. Perhaps you want the app to visually differ from your brand/logo/website.

How should users navigate around the app? What a navigation flow looks like when users use the app. How can you support the user's behavior in the app through the navigation?

 

Set a realistic budget

How much does it cost to develop an app?

That question is difficult to answer, because it depends on many different factors: the app's complexity, functionalities, design requirements, the type of app etc.

All the aforementioned questions and considerations help to define the development project, and thus it is also easier for us to give you a realistic budget framework for the development project.

In addition to the price for the development process itself, you should also budget for maintenance of the app. This includes, among other things, ongoing updates and optimizations. As the target group uses the app, you will most likely also get feedback on errors and wishes for new functions. Therefore, you should also set a budget for operation and maintenance of the app.

 

Be patient

An app is not developed overnight. All the factors that affect the development price will also affect the duration of the development process. The more functions and integrations the app must have, the longer it typically takes to develop the app.

During the development process, the app must also be tested. This is an important part of the development process, ensuring that errors are detected and corrected quickly. The app developer or developers will do this as a fixed part of their work process, but you should also test the app yourself in the final phase of the development process.

In order to be successful with the app, these tests are very important, as they will reveal any errors and shortcomings. Make sure to test different usage situations – and be patient in the testing phase so that you can test all functions and usage situations.

 

Future prospects for the app

When an app is ready to go on the market, it does not mean that the app is fully developed and does not require more development hours. Updates and bug fixes will need to be made on an ongoing basis, and it may also be necessary to introduce new features.

When the app is released in version 1.0, it will have all the most important core functions, need to have, but it may also be that you have ideas for new functions that are more nice to have. Although these have not been included in version 1.0, this does not mean that they should not be included in version 2.0 or 5.0.

It is therefore important that you consider the app's scalability right from the start of the development project.
